  4. Revelo Intel’s CEO Nick Drakon has recently resigned after a terrible armed robbery incident. This brings into focus the safety of individuals dealing with large amounts of digital resources.

    The Armed Robbery Incident

    Former CEO of Revelo Intel, Nick Drakon, was attacked by criminals at gunpoint, forcing him to explain how he invests in cryptocurrency. The attackers targeted Drakon because of his prominence in the crypto world and assumed security over assets. Drakon resigned from his position following the physical and emotional trauma.

    Increased Risk Concerns In Crypto

    This attack highlights an increasing danger in the crypto sphere, particularly for those managing large sums of coins. Cryptocurrencies are usually stored in users’ wallets and not as institutional assets. Anyone obtaining these private keys can make instant transfers, putting individuals at high risk of losing their money.

    Quote (Nick Drakon): "It’s been almost 4 years since I entered the crypto space, and my time here has been mostly fantastic. I've met hundreds of interesting and kind people, some of whom I now consider great friends."

    Effect on Crypto Leadership and Business

    Drakon’s resignation highlights significant issues in the crypto industry concerning its leaders. Managers and owners, like Drakon, usually hold valuable keys and specific knowledge, making them easy targets. This event may lead other firms to enhance their security measures for top executives.

    There might also be changes in how crypto organizations manage their executives due to growing physical threats and regulatory pressures. This could raise concerns about the stability and continuity of management in crypto firms.

    The armed robbery that forced Nick Drakon, CEO of Revelo Intel, into resignation underscores the physical threats emerging in the crypto market. As cryptocurrencies grow in importance, so does the need to protect key individuals. Ensuring the safety of leaders like Drakon is crucial for maintaining trust in the cryptocurrency market and preventing increasing threats.
